        <p>Like all volumes in the series, the book offers wide-ranging cultural reflections and insights relevant to corporate governance. Traditionally, realism is identified with a disillusioned approach to reality opposing to any form of ideology or utopia; the works proposes instead a strategic realism that supports an entrepreneurial humanism, while avoiding both cynicism and idealism at the same time. So is to be the strategy understood: convenience selects the achievable advantages; interest is the drive for change; the stratagem relies on the propensity of events; the plan traces the route of the wished opportunities; the action collects the opportunities.</p>

        <p>Come tutti i volumi della collana il libro propone riflessioni ed approfondimenti culturali ad ampio raggio funzionali al governo d'impresa. Tradizionalmente il realismo viene identificato in un approccio disincantato alla realtà che si contrappone ad ogni forma di ideologia o di utopia; qui si propone un realismo strategico che supporti un umanesimo imprenditoriale rifuggendo al contempo sia dal cinismo, sia dall'idealismo. In tal senso nella strategia: la convenienza seleziona i vantaggi perseguibili; l'interesse è la spinta al cambiamento; lo stratagemma fa leva sulla propensione degli eventi; il piano traccia la rotta delle opportunità evocate; l'azione le raccoglie.</p>
